Attic Insulation Top-Up

If your North Tustin home has original R-11 or R-19 fiberglass batts that have settled over 40 or 50 years, you may not need full removal. A top-up adds blown-in insulation over the existing material to bring the total R-value up to current California Title 24 minimums, which for attics in this climate zone means R-38 or better. Top-ups cost $0.90–$1.80 per square foot and are the most budget-friendly way to get a meaningful performance gain. But here’s the catch with North Tustin attics specifically: if air bypasses haven’t been sealed first, you’re just piling insulation on top of a leak. We address sealing before we add material.

Common Attic Insulation Problems We See in North Tustin Homes

Settled original batts that have lost most of their R-value. Homes built between 1960 and 1990 typically got R-11 or R-19 fiberglass batts. Forty years of gravity and foot traffic compresses that material to a fraction of its rated depth, especially in the vaulted ceiling cavities common throughout the foothills.
Unsealed recessed-light cans pulling desert air into living spaces. During Santa Ana events, the pressure differential across your roofline turns every unsealed penetration into a miniature air duct. We’ve measured 90°F air flowing from light cans in a North Tustin great room during a wind event.
Improper or missing baffles choking ventilation. Multi-gable rooflines, common to the custom homes in North Tustin, are notoriously hard to vent properly. When baffles are misaligned or absent, soffit airflow stops, the attic superheats, and the insulation becomes the thermal bridge into the house.
Wet or contaminated insulation from undiagnosed roof leaks. Hillside homes endure concentrated wind-driven rain. Small leaks at flashing or skylights saturate insulation over years, collapsing the R-value and creating mold conditions before anyone notices a stain on the ceiling.

The Santa Ana Wind Problem: Why North Tustin Attics Fail Differently

Here’s what most insulation contractors miss. North Tustin’s hillside lots sit directly in the Santa Ana wind corridor that funnels through Santiago Canyon and over Loma Ridge. When the winds blow, they create a pressure differential across the building envelope, higher on the canyon-facing side, lower on the leeward side. That pressure differential turns every unsealed gap, every top-plate crack, every recessed-light penetration into a pressurized air pathway. Hot desert air doesn’t just drift into your attic. It gets pulled into it, and then pulled further into your living space. Homes off Newport Avenue and along Cowan Heights are particularly exposed.

This is a failure mode flat-coastal Orange County contractors rarely diagnose because the houses they work on don’t experience the same pressure dynamics. A home in Tustin proper or Irvine sits on level ground with a fraction of the ridge-level wind loading. The fixes that work there don’t necessarily work here. FAQs — Attic Insulation in North Tustin

Why does my North Tustin home’s attic insulation underperform during Santa Ana winds even though it looks thick?

The visible thickness is misleading if the insulation isn’t paired with air sealing. Insulation only resists conductive heat loss. It does nothing to stop air movement. During Santa Ana events, canyon-side pressure differentials push hot air through bypasses and gaps that would be dormant on a calm day. If your insulation is thick but you still feel heat during a wind event, your problem is air sealing, not insulation depth.

Can you upgrade attic insulation in a home with vaulted ceilings without tearing out the drywall?

Yes, in most cases. Blown-in insulation can reach vaulted ceiling cavities through the unvented attic side, provided there’s enough access clearance. For severely sloped or enclosed cathedral ceiling sections, we can inject through small, patched access points or use spray foam from the attic side. The drywall stays intact. We’ve done this on dozens of custom homes throughout North Tustin’s hillside neighborhoods.

How much attic insulation does a North Tustin hillside home need to meet current California Title 24?

For attics in North Tustin’s climate zone, the current minimum is R-38. That’s roughly 12–14 inches of blown-in fiberglass or cellulose, or about 16 inches of settled loose-fill for best performance. Many original North Tustin attics have R-11 to R-19, so most homes are at half of code or less. We typically insulate to R-38 or higher, and we’ll confirm what your specific roofline supports during the walkthrough.

What are the first signs that my North Tustin attic insulation has failed?

The most reliable early signal is heat radiating from the ceiling during summer afternoons, especially in rooms with recessed lighting. High energy bills year-round, temperature differences between rooms, and drafts that worsen during Santa Ana events are also common indicators. In winter, watch for condensation or moisture staining at ceiling edges, which points to thermal bypasses at the top plates.

Is it worth adding a radiant barrier when I re-insulate my attic in North Tustin?

For a hillside home that gets 8–12°F hotter in summer than coastal cities, a radiant barrier makes a meaningful difference. It reflects radiant heat from the roof deck before it can radiate into the attic and then into your living space. Combined with R-38 insulation and proper air sealing, it’s often the difference between an attic that’s merely insulated and one that actually stays stable during heat waves.
